WebFluted chambers are longitudinal flutes which are deeper at the forward end of the chamber and taper off towards the rear. These allow the gases produced on firing to … http://forums.accuratereloading.com/eve/forums/a/tpc/f/9411043/m/3141001002/xsl/print_topic

WebJan 8, 2024 · Hence the fluted chambers (HK weren't the first to do this, the Mauser StG45/Gerat 06H used fluted chambers for the same exact reason, and the SIA 1918 LMG was a delayed blowback machine gun that incorporated a fluted chamber, hence the rarely used alternative name Revelli grooves). WebFeb 2, 2014 · Fluted chambers started being used when the first self-loaders were being adopted by the world's militaries. The early designs lacked primary extraction and the trapped gas between the case and chamber wall helped the case release from the chamber and the anemic extraction of early designs became more reliable.
